Baked Stuffed Peppers

60 min serves 4
VegetarianGluten-Free
14gprotein35gcarbs22gfat

Ingredients

  • 1 bell pepper
  • ½ cup brown rice
  • 2 tablespoons butter
  • ¼ cup celery
  • 2 eggs
  • 4 oz canned green chiles
  • 1 onion
  • ¼ teaspoon oregano leaves
  • ¼ cup parsley
  • 5 peppers
  • salt
  • ½ cup sharp cheddar cheese
  • ½ cup sunflower seeds

Method

From foodista.com — read the original

  1. Cook rice in 1-1/2 cups boiling salted water for 35 minutes or until tender.
  2. Drain if necessary. Set aside.
  3. Cut peppers in half.
  4. Remove seeds and white membrane. Parboil peppers in boiling salted water for 5 minutes. Arrange in slightly oiled, shallow 1-1/2 quart baking dish. Melt butter in small skillet.
  5. Add onion, celery, and sunflower seeds.
  6. Saute until onion is tender.
  7. Remove from heat. Stir into rice.
  8. Add parsley, eggs,oregano, chiles, black pepper, and salt to taste. Fill peppers with mixture.
  9. Sprinkle cheese on top. Put about 1/3 cup hot water in bottom of dish.
  10. Bake at 400°F for about 20 minutes.
